WitrynaYour Steak Containing Protein The most protein-dense meat is beef top sirloin, which contains about 78 grams of protein in a 9-ounce chunk. The same amount of tenderloin has almost 73 grams of protein, while a rib-eye steak contains 72 grams of protein in a 9-ounce cut, and a flank steak includes 70 grams of protein in the same quantity of … ragland\u0027s carpet cleaning lebanon tn
